Heat pump water heaters (“HPWH”) are the most energy efficient and environmentally-friendly choice. They heat water by pulling heat from the surrounding air and transferring it to the water. The process can be four times more efficient than traditional gas-fired water heaters, which burn natural gas to generate heat or electric resistance water heaters, which create heat by running electricity though metal.
